* ✨ Improve path operations and edition * 🐛 Fix floating-point equality issues in path editing Replace exact equality checks with tolerance-based comparisons in path editing functions to handle floating-point rounding differences after transforms, rotations, or curve fitting. Changes: - distribute-content: Round coordinates to 0.1 precision before grouping to ensure coincident nodes move together - separate-node: Use gpt/close? instead of exact equality to find nodes with floating-point imprecision - collision-step: Use mth/close? for tolerance-based comparison to detect paste collisions correctly - resolve-edit-fills: Add cycle detection to prevent infinite loops with corrupted parent chains Made collision-step, available-offset-step, and resolve-edit-fills public for better testability. Added comprehensive tests for all fixes covering both exact and floating-point coordinate scenarios. AI-assisted-by: qwen3.7-plus * 🐛 Fix path editor code review findings Fix issues identified during code review of path editor enhancements: - Fix unused binding lint warning in distribute-content that blocked CI - Fix collision-step floor comparison to use round instead of floor, correctly detecting collisions when coordinates drift slightly below integer boundaries - Fix resolve-edit-fills to recurse through empty parent groups when searching for inherited fills in nested group hierarchies - Fix expand-coincident-node-indices to use fuzzy comparison (gpt/close?) instead of exact equality, handling floating-point divergence after transforms or rotations - Remove unreachable dead code in path-point* on-pointer-down handler - Add tests for collision-step boundary cases, nested group fill inheritance, and coincident node alignment/flipping AI-assisted-by: mimo-v2.5-pro --------- Co-authored-by: Andrey Antukh <niwi@niwi.nz>
